Choosing the Right Robot Vacuum Under $300
Suction Power: The Core of Cleaning Performance
Suction power, measured in Pascals (Pa), is arguably the most important factor when choosing a robot vacuum. Higher suction means better pickup of dirt, dust, and especially pet hair. For homes with carpets, look for models offering at least 5000Pa of suction. This ensures the vacuum can agitate carpet fibers and lift embedded debris. Lower suction (around 2000-3000Pa) may be sufficient for hard floors and light cleaning, but you’ll likely need to run the vacuum more frequently. Some models offer “Auto Boost” features, intelligently increasing suction when transitioning to carpets – a very useful feature. Consider your floor types and the amount of debris you typically deal with when prioritizing suction power.
Navigation & Mapping: Efficiency & Thoroughness
How a robot vacuum navigates your home significantly impacts its cleaning efficiency. Basic models use random bounce patterns, which can be slow and miss spots. However, most robot vacuums in the $200-$300 range now offer more advanced navigation technologies. LiDAR (Light Detection and Ranging) navigation is a standout, using lasers to create accurate maps of your home. This allows for systematic cleaning paths, efficient room coverage, and the ability to set virtual boundaries (no-go zones) via a smartphone app. Mapping is especially beneficial for multi-story homes, as many vacuums can save multiple floor plans. Simpler gyroscopic navigation is also available, but generally isn’t as precise as LiDAR.
2-in-1 vs. Vacuum-Only: Mopping Capabilities
Many robot vacuums offer both vacuuming and mopping functionality. These 2-in-1 models typically include a water tank and a microfiber mopping pad. While convenient, the mopping performance varies. Some models offer adjustable water flow control, allowing you to customize the amount of moisture used for different floor types. Keep in mind that robot mop features are generally best for light surface cleaning and maintaining floors rather than deep scrubbing. If you prioritize mopping, look for models with dedicated mopping modes and adjustable water settings. If you have mostly carpets, a vacuum-only model might be a better choice.
Battery Life & Self-Emptying: Convenience Features
Battery life dictates how much area a robot vacuum can clean on a single charge. Look for models offering at least 90-120 minutes of runtime. Models with auto-recharge and resume capabilities will automatically return to the charging dock when the battery is low and then continue cleaning where they left off. Self-emptying bases are a game-changer for convenience. These bases automatically suck the dirt and debris from the robot’s dustbin into a larger disposable bag, reducing the frequency of manual emptying. However, self-emptying bases typically add to the overall cost of the robot vacuum.
Additional Features to Consider
- App Control: Smartphone app control allows for scheduling, remote control, and access to advanced features like virtual walls.
- Voice Control: Compatibility with Alexa or Google Assistant enables hands-free operation.
- Brushroll Design: Anti-tangle brushrolls prevent hair from wrapping around the brush, reducing maintenance.
- Filter Type: HEPA filters trap allergens and dust mites, improving air quality.
- Noise Level: Consider the noise level if you plan to run the vacuum while you’re home.
